Braves' David Fletcher continuing to play in minors amid reported MLB investigation into illegal bets

David Fletcher is continuing to play in the Atlanta Braves' minor league system while MLB probes a report of him gambling illegally.

The infielder was in the lineup for the Triple-A Gwinnett Stripers on Tuesday, a day after ESPN reported MLB had opened an investigation into his involvement with illegal bookmaker Mathew Bowyer, the same bookie involved in the Ippei Mizuhara-Shohei Ohtani scandal.

Fletcher was previously reported to have made bets on sports with Bowyer, but not on baseball. Placing illegal bets is still a violation of MLB rules, though, with punishment at the discretion of Rob Manfred.
